Went with burgs for the feast for 11 people: 2008 Dom. Rossignole Volnay and 2010 Roux Pere & Fils Pouilly-Fuisse. One turkey breast was cooked in a crock pot and a 17 lb whole bird was smoked over oak, 200-220 deg. F. for 5 1/2 hours. Sides were pretty traditional - sage dressing, whole cranberries, etc. - but daughter's spud & leek casserole blew everyone away! Desserts included a chocolate pecan pie, and that's as far a I got.

The wines were OUTSTANDING! (hic, burp)
